分布式存储方式详解
一、引言
随着信息技术的飞速发展,数据量呈爆炸式增长,传统的集中式存储方式已经难以满足日益增长的存储需求,分布式存储作为一种新兴的存储技术,具有高可靠性、高扩展性、高性能等优点,已经成为当前存储领域的研究热点,本文将详细介绍分布式存储方式的分类、特点以及应用场景。
二、分布式存储方式的分类
(一)分布式文件系统
分布式文件系统是一种将文件系统分布在多个节点上的存储方式,它将文件系统的元数据(如文件名、文件目录、文件权限等)存储在一个中心节点上,而将文件的数据存储在多个数据节点上,分布式文件系统可以提供高可靠性、高扩展性和高性能的文件存储服务,广泛应用于大数据处理、云计算等领域。
(二)分布式块存储
分布式块存储是一种将块设备(如磁盘、SSD 等)分布在多个节点上的存储方式,它将块设备的元数据(如块设备名称、块设备大小、块设备类型等)存储在一个中心节点上,而将块设备的数据存储在多个数据节点上,分布式块存储可以提供高可靠性、高扩展性和高性能的块存储服务,广泛应用于数据库、虚拟化等领域。
(三)分布式对象存储
分布式对象存储是一种将对象(如文件、图片、视频等)分布在多个节点上的存储方式,它将对象的元数据(如对象名称、对象大小、对象类型等)存储在一个中心节点上,而将对象的数据存储在多个数据节点上,分布式对象存储可以提供高可靠性、高扩展性和高性能的对象存储服务,广泛应用于互联网、移动互联网等领域。
三、分布式存储方式的特点
(一)高可靠性
分布式存储方式通过将数据分布在多个节点上,可以有效地避免单点故障,提高系统的可靠性,当某个节点出现故障时,系统可以自动将数据迁移到其他正常的节点上,保证数据的可用性。
(二)高扩展性
分布式存储方式可以通过增加节点的数量来扩展系统的存储容量和性能,当系统的存储需求增加时,只需要增加相应数量的节点即可,无需对整个系统进行升级和改造。
(三)高性能
分布式存储方式通过将数据分布在多个节点上,可以实现并行读写,提高系统的性能,分布式存储方式还可以通过数据冗余和数据副本等技术来提高系统的可靠性和容错性。
(四)灵活的部署方式
分布式存储方式可以根据不同的应用场景和需求,采用不同的部署方式,可以采用集中式部署、分布式部署、混合部署等方式,以满足不同的存储需求。
四、分布式存储方式的应用场景
(一)大数据处理
大数据处理需要处理海量的数据,传统的集中式存储方式已经难以满足需求,分布式存储方式可以提供高可靠性、高扩展性和高性能的存储服务,满足大数据处理的需求。
(二)云计算
云计算需要提供高可靠、高可用、高性能的存储服务,分布式存储方式可以满足云计算的需求,分布式存储方式可以将数据分布在多个节点上,实现数据的冗余和备份,提高系统的可靠性和容错性。
(三)数据库
数据库需要提供高可靠、高可用、高性能的存储服务,分布式存储方式可以满足数据库的需求,分布式存储方式可以将数据分布在多个节点上,实现数据的并行读写,提高系统的性能。
(四)互联网
互联网需要提供高可靠、高可用、高性能的存储服务,分布式存储方式可以满足互联网的需求,分布式存储方式可以将数据分布在多个节点上,实现数据的冗余和备份,提高系统的可靠性和容错性。
五、结论
分布式存储方式作为一种新兴的存储技术,具有高可靠性、高扩展性、高性能等优点,已经成为当前存储领域的研究热点,本文详细介绍了分布式存储方式的分类、特点以及应用场景,希望能够对读者有所帮助。
评论列表